Program p; var x: integer; // видна везде procedure p1; // видна везде var y: integer; // видна внутри p1 begin p2; // ошибка: не видна в p1 end; procedure p2; // видна везде, кроме р1 var z: integer; // видна внутри р2 begin {тело процедуры} end; procedure p3; // видна в основной программе var m: integer; // видна внутри р3 begin p1; end; begin {тело основной программы} p3; end.
msk27
14.03.2020
Pascalabc.net 3.3.5, сборка 1662 от 29.04.2018 внимание! если программа не работает, обновите версию! begin var (sn,pp,kp): =(0,1,0); var n: integer; repeat read(n); if (n< 0) and n.isodd then sn+=n else if (n> 0) and (n mod 3=0) then begin pp*=n; kp+=1 end until n=0; if sn=0 then begin writeln('нет отрицательных нечетных чисел'); if kp=0 then writeln('нет положительных чисел, кратных 3') else writeln('произведение положительных чисел, кратных 3: ',pp) end else begin writeln('сумма отрицательных нечетных чисел: ',sn); if kp=0 then writeln('нет положительных чисел, кратных 3') else writeln('произведение положительных чисел, кратных 3: ',pp) end end. пример -367 23 62 7 12 -24 90 152 -63 0 сумма отрицательных нечетных чисел: -430 произведение положительных чисел, кратных 3: 1080
Ответить на вопрос
Поделитесь своими знаниями, ответьте на вопрос:
Вячейке d7 записана формула (c3 + c5)/d6. как она изменится при переносе этой формулы в ячейку: а)d8; б)e7; в)c6; г)f10